What Is a Neuromodulator?

A neuromodulator is an injectable treatment that temporarily relaxes targeted facial muscles responsible for certain expression lines.

Every time you frown, squint, raise your brows, or concentrate, specific muscles contract. Over time, those repeated movements can create lines that stay visible even when your face is at rest.

Neuromodulators work by softening the muscle activity in carefully selected areas. The result is a smoother, more relaxed appearance — without changing your identity or taking away natural expression.

Common neuromodulator treatment areas for men may include:

  • Frown lines between the brows, often called “11 lines”
  • Forehead lines
  • Crow’s feet around the eyes
  • Neck bands, when appropriate
  • Other areas depending on anatomy and treatment goals

Botox Cosmetic and Dysport are two examples of neuromodulators. Botox Cosmetic is FDA-labeled for temporary improvement in moderate to severe frown lines, crow’s feet, forehead lines, and platysma bands in adults; Dysport is FDA-labeled for temporary improvement in moderate to severe glabellar lines in adults.

Will Neuromodulators Make Men Look Frozen?

This is one of the most common concerns men have, and it is a fair question.

The answer depends on the injector, the treatment plan, the dose, and the goal.

At Recharge Clinic, I do not believe men should be treated with a cookie-cutter approach. Men often have stronger facial muscles, different brow structure, different facial proportions, and different aesthetic goals than women.

Some men want a very conservative treatment that simply takes the edge off deep lines. Others want a smoother, more relaxed look while still maintaining natural movement.

Either way, the goal is balance.

A well-done neuromodulator treatment should respect your facial structure, preserve your masculinity, and keep you looking like yourself.

FAQs About Neuromodulators for Men

1. What is the difference between Botox, Dysport, and a neuromodulator?

A neuromodulator is the general category of treatment. Botox Cosmetic and Dysport are brand names within that category. They are injectable treatments used to temporarily soften muscle activity that contributes to certain expression lines.

2. Will people know I had a neuromodulator treatment?

Not if the treatment is done thoughtfully. Most men want subtle results, and the goal is usually to look more rested and refreshed — not noticeably treated.

3. Do neuromodulator treatments hurt?

Most patients find the treatment very tolerable. The injections are quick, and discomfort is usually minimal.

4. How long do results last?

Results vary from person to person, but neuromodulator treatments are temporary. During your consultation, we will discuss what you can realistically expect and how maintenance may fit your goals.

5. Is there downtime after treatment?

Downtime is typically minimal, and many patients return to normal daily activities afterward. You will be given specific aftercare instructions based on your treatment plan.
